Lucé (French pronunciation: [lyse]) is a former commune in the Orne department in north-western France. On 1 January 2016, it was merged into the new commune of Juvigny Val d'Andaine.[2] The Anglo-Norman family of the same name (de Lucy, anciently de Luci) derived from this French village.[3]
